North Korea-Venezuela Trade: In 2013, North Korea exported $28.9M to Venezuela. The main products that North Korea exported to Venezuela were N/A. Over the past 5 years the exports of North Korea to Venezuela have decreased at an annualized rate of 32.5%, from $206M in 2008 to $28.9M in 2013.

In 2013, North Korea did not export any services to Venezuela.

Venezuela-North Korea Trade: In 2013, Venezuela exported $8.57k to North Korea. The main products that Venezuela exported to North Korea were N/A. Over the past 5 years the exports of Venezuela to North Korea have decreased at an annualized rate of 51.2%,  from $5.44M in 2008 to $8.57k in 2013.

In 2013, Venezuela did not export any services to North Korea.

Comparison In 2023,  North Korea ranked 172 in total exports ($397M), and does not have data regarding Economic Complexity Index. That same year, Venezuela ranked 100 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I -0.82), and 113 in total exports ($7.63B).

This map shows whether countries import more from North Korea or Venezuela. Each country is colored based on the difference in imports they receive from North Korea and Venezuela or the difference in the growth in imports.

In 2023, countries that imported more from North Korea than Venezuela included Angola ($10.2M), Senegal ($10.3M), and Austria ($10.1M).

In 2023, countries that imported more from Venezuela than North Korea included United States ($3.81B), Spain ($670M), and Brazil ($468M).
